It was Simon Easterby who led Ireland in the most recent Six Nations Championship in 2025, taking temporary charge after Head Coach Andy Farrell was chosen to lead the British & Irish Lions for the tour of Australia. Farrell will be back in charge of the Ireland team when they meet Wales at the Aviva Stadium in March 2026.
Andy Farrell has been in charge of Ireland since he was appointed to replace New Zealand’s Joe Schmidt in 2019, who had been in charge for six years. Since then, Farrell has overseen a period that has seen Ireland win two Six Nations Championships (2023 & 2024), the former of which was a Grand Slam, whilst the nation also won two Triple Crowns, doing so back in 2022 and 2023.
In the most recent Six Nations Championship in 2025, it was to be a creditable 3rd place finish after earning a total of 19 points after winning 4 and losing just one of their 5 games overall, and it was only England and reigning Champions France who finished ahead of them on 20 and 21 points respectively.
Ireland’s four victories came against England (27 – 22), Scotland (18 – 32), Wales (18 – 27), and Italy (17 – 22), with their only defeat coming against Champions France, who were able to beat them 27 – 42 at the Aviva Stadium in Dublin.
The aforementioned game against Wales is their most recent competitive encounter ahead of this much anticipated game.
Ireland and Wales met in competitive international rugby for the very first time at Landsdowne Road in Dublin during the 1881/82 Home Nations Internationals back on 28th January 1882, and it was won by Wales. Ireland’s first competitive victory against Wales came in the 1888 Home Nations Championship at Lansdowne Park on 3rd March 1888.
